Austria's Eurovision scout Eberhard Forcher discusses his approach to helping ORF choose its Eurovision artists. Eberhard takes us through the internal selection process for each of the ESC acts he has been involved in choosing in some capacity -- Zoe, Nathan Trent, Cesar Sampson, Paenda, and Vincent Bueno. There's also a lot of tea about choosing an act for Eurovision 2022. UPDATE: Since filming this earlier in November, Eberhard has told us that ORF is likely to make its decision by the end of January, and that the process is now down to just THREE acts.
